When a book starts with a playlist, you know it’s going to be a good one.
In all honesty, when I started this book I hated it. The writing style was not for me. I hated the dropping of pronouns at the start of sentences, and don’t get me started on the use of “prolly” instead of probably.
BUT I very quickly got drawn in by the characters, I loved their development, their chemistry, their story. Aurora, a girl who’s been running from her fears for 12 years is a character I think a lot of us can relate to. And Wyatt, a heartbroken man who’d still do anything for the girl who abandoned him? He’s the most lovable character. The book developed beautifully, and we got the ending we wanted.
The spice was more than I could have hoped for 🌶️🌶️🌶️🌶️🌶️
